Grenada, Authority of October 1814, Two Bitts (valued at One Shilling and Sixpence), a cut sixth-segment of a Spanish-American 8 Réales, obv. countermarked with gs raised within a rectangular indent, incuse g and 2 raised within a shaped indent, 4.30g/66.4gr (Prid. 12 [Sale, lot 363]; KM. 6). Coin and countermarks fine or better, of the highest rarity; only one other specimen recorded [Pridmore lot 363] £1,500-2,000

Provenance: Henry Christensen Auction 79, 11-12 December 1981, lot 394; R.C. Gordon Collection, Baldwin Auction 8, 7 October 1996, lot 125; E. Roehrs Collection, Part I, DNW Auction 87, 28 September 2010, lot 297
